SaveFormat

SaveFormat enumeration

Указывает формат, в котором сохраняется документ.

public enum SaveFormat

Ценности

ИмяЦенностьОписание
Unknown0По умолчанию, недопустимое значение формата файла.
Doc10Сохраняет документ в формате документа Microsoft Word 97 – 2007.
Dot11Сохраняет документ в формате шаблона Microsoft Word 97 – 2007.
Docx20Сохраняет документ как документ Office Open XML WordprocessingML (без макросов).
Docm21Сохраняет документ как документ Office Open XML WordprocessingML с поддержкой макросов.
Dotx22Сохраняет документ как шаблон Office Open XML WordprocessingML (без макросов).
Dotm23Сохраняет документ как шаблон Office Open XML WordprocessingML с поддержкой макросов.
FlatOpc24Сохраняет документ как Office Open XML WordprocessingML, хранящийся в простом XML-файле, а не в ZIP-пакете.
FlatOpcMacroEnabled25Сохраняет документ как документ Office Open XML WordprocessingML с поддержкой макросов, хранящийся в простом XML-файле, а не в ZIP-пакете.
FlatOpcTemplate26Сохраняет документ как шаблон Office Open XML WordprocessingML (без макросов), хранящийся в простом XML-файле, а не в ZIP-пакете.
FlatOpcTemplateMacroEnabled27Сохраняет документ как шаблон Office Open XML WordprocessingML с поддержкой макросов, хранящийся в простом XML-файле, а не в ZIP-пакете.
Rtf30Сохраняет документ в формате RTF. Все символы длиной более 7 бит экранируются как шестнадцатеричные символы или символы Юникода.
WordML31Сохраняет документ в формате Microsoft Word 2003 WordprocessingML.
Pdf40Сохраняет документ в формате PDF (Adobe Portable Document).
Xps41Сохраняет документ в формате XPS (спецификация бумаги XML).
XamlFixed42Сохраняет документ в формате расширяемого языка разметки приложений (XAML) как фиксированный документ.
Svg44Сохраняет документ в формате Svg (масштабируемая векторная графика).
HtmlFixed45Сохраняет документ в формате HTML, используя абсолютно позиционированные элементы
OpenXps46Сохраняет документ в формате OpenXPS (Ecma-388).
Ps47Сохраняет документ в формате PS (PostScript).
Pcl48Сохраняет документ в формате PCL (язык управления принтером).
Html50Сохраняет документ в формате HTML.
Mhtml51Сохраняет документ в формате MHTML (веб-архив).
Epub52Сохраняет документ в формате EPUB.
Azw353Сохраняет документ в формате AZW3.
Mobi54Сохраняет документ в формате MOBI.
Odt60Сохраняет документ как текстовый документ ODF.
Ott61Сохраняет документ как шаблон текстового документа ODF.
Text70Сохраняет документ в текстовом формате.
XamlFlow71Бета. Сохраняет документ в формате расширяемого языка разметки приложений (XAML) как потоковый документ.
XamlFlowPack72Бета. Сохраняет документ в формате пакета расширяемого языка разметки приложений (XAML) как потоковый документ.
Markdown73Сохраняет документ в формате Markdown.
Xlsx80Сохраняет документ как документ Office Open XML SpreadsheetML (без макросов).
Tiff100Отрисовывает страницу или страницы документа и сохраняет их в одностраничный или многостраничный файл TIFF.
Png101Отрисовывает страницу документа и сохраняет ее как файл PNG.
Bmp102Отрисовывает страницу документа и сохраняет ее как файл BMP.
Emf103Отрисовывает страницу документа и сохраняет ее как векторный файл EMF (Enhanced Meta File).
Jpeg104Отрисовывает страницу документа и сохраняет ее как файл JPEG.
Gif105Отрисовывает страницу документа и сохраняет ее как файл GIF.
Eps106Отрисовывает страницу документа и сохраняет ее как файл EPS.

Примеры

Показывает, как конвертировать формат DOCX в HTML.

Document doc = new Document(MyDir + "Document.docx");

doc.Save(ArtifactsDir + "Document.ConvertToHtml.html", SaveFormat.Html);

Смотрите также